"There Are Lessons To Be Learnt In What Is Going On In South Africa Today" -FFK Says

Fani-Kayode have taken to his Instagram page and talked about the crisis currently going on in South Africa.

Fani-Kayode

Fani-Kayode is a popular Nigerian politician, he was the former aviation minister of Nigeria.

According to a recent Instagram post that was made by the popular Nigerian politician, Fani-Kayode took to his Instagram page and reacted to the crisis currently going on in South Africa.

Fani-Kayode wrote on his Instagram page:

"There are many lessons to be learnt about what is going on in South Africa today as a consequence of the jailing of Jacob Zuma. 

Hi Zulu people have risen up and over 70 people have been killed so far. There is rage on the streets and the loser here is Cyril Ramaphosa.

When you lock up, persecute or kill those who are regarded as heroes by their ethnic group you are waking up a lion that cannot be controlled or contained. 

You are also stirring up and kindling a fire which may consumme the entire nation. Nigeria has much to learn from this.

We must be fair and just. We must learn to fear God and desist from targetting and persecuting the innocent. 

We must stop planting the seeds of division and violence. We must stop pulling the tail of the lion and baiting its rage. When you kill a madman you will know he has followers".
